mcphub

A unified hub for centralized management and dynamic organization of multiple MCP servers into streamable HTTP (SSE) endpoints, with support for flexible routing strategies

GitHub Stars

1,190

User Rating

Not Rated

Favorites

0

Views

51

Forks

141

Issues

25

Technical Information

Programming Languages

TypeScriptPrimary Language

System Requirements

Node.js: 18.0.0 or higher
npm: 8.0.0 or higher

Provided Features

Broadened MCP Server Support: Seamlessly integrate any MCP server with minimal configuration.
Centralized Dashboard: Monitor real-time status and performance metrics from one sleek web UI.
Flexible Protocol Handling: Full compatibility with both stdio and SSE MCP protocols.
Hot-Swappable Configuration: Add, remove, or update MCP servers on the fly — no downtime required.
Group-Based Access Control: Organize servers into customizable groups for streamlined permissions management.
Secure Authentication: Built-in user management with role-based access powered by JWT and bcrypt.
Docker-Ready: Deploy instantly with our containerized setup.

Safety Analysis

Safety Score
Safe100/100

Recommended For

Recommended for developers looking to manage MCP servers, particularly teams working on projects involving multiple servers.

Maintenance Status

Active

GitHub Topics

mcpmcp-hubmcp-routermcp-server